What a waste

An ICM/Guardian poll has found that 65% of voters, including the majority of Labour supporters, do not think the government makes good use of tax money.

Is it merely coincidence that the modern political narrative is driven solely by the who pays how much agenda, and is devoid of any examination of what happens to the tax once it is collected ?

With tax is at its highest for more than a decade, and the government not exactly flush with the readies, where does it all go and what effect does the lack of accountability have on the willingness of people to evade the payment of tax ?
